Why Proper Chimney Flashing Matters in Ennis, TX

Rain, hail, heat, and even those rare cold fronts—weather in Ennis, Texas packs a punch. Your chimney flashing is the thin sheet metal that seals the area where your chimney and roof meet. This simple piece of metal has a tough job. If it fails, water can sneak into your attic, your ceilings, and even your living space. That means trouble for your woodwork, insulation, and electrical systems.

Ignoring flashing problems can lead to mold, wood rot, and high repair costs. Fixing it now is a lot cheaper than rebuilding parts of your house later. Your flashing does not just guard your chimney—it guards your wallet, too.

Common Chimney Flashing Problems We Fix in Ennis, Texas

Have you seen rust streaks down your bricks? How about shingles curling up next to the chimney? If you spot these problems, you’re not alone. Many homes in Ennis, zip codes like 75119 or 75125, face these same issues. Here are some typical chimney flashing troubles we tackle every day:

  • Leaky Chimney Flashing

    Rainwater coming in through the chimney is never a good sign. If you see water stains on your ceiling or walls close to the fireplace, that’s a red flag. Flashing that’s cracked, loose, or rusted cannot do its job. In Ennis, this usually happens after a heavy storm or simply years of Texas weather taking its toll.

  • Rusted or Corroded Flashing

    Ennis weather can be tough—one minute it’s pouring rain and the next the sun is blazing. This kind of weather makes metal flashing rust or corrode faster. When flashing begins to rust, it breaks apart, making it easy for water to get inside. SafeFlue Chimney Sweep & Repair can swap out rusted flashing with strong, weather-resistant materials.

  • Deteriorating Mortar or Caulk

    Sometimes water does not even wait for metal to give up. If the mortar or caulk sealing your flashing has separated or flaked away, leaks are bound to happen. We see this often in homes built before 1980, but it can happen to any home that’s weathered a Texas summer (or two).

  • Improper Flashing Installation

    Did someone use tar instead of proper metal flashing? Did the last roofer skip a step? Flashing that is not installed right is a problem waiting to happen, usually when a Texas thunderstorm rolls through. SafeFlue’s team corrects these shortcuts with real flashing that works.

Our Step-By-Step Chimney Flashing Replacement

Ready to swap out that old flashing? Here’s how SafeFlue makes the process painless:

  • Remove Old Flashing

    First, we carefully take out the damaged metal, old nails, and any leftover sealant or tar. We check for wood rot or shingle problems underneath and fix them before moving on.

  • Prep the Chimney and Roof

    We clean and prepare the areas where new flashing will go. This gives you a dry, smooth base so the new flashing will stick and seal for years.

  • Install New Metal Flashing

    Using high-grade galvanized steel, aluminum, or even copper flashing (your choice), we custom-fit each piece to your chimney. We tuck the flashing into your bricks and shingles so water cannot creep in, then seal every edge for total protection.

  • Final Inspection and Testing

    Before we pack up, we check all our work inside and outside. We even spray down the area to test for leaks. You get results you can see right away.

How to Tell Your Chimney Flashing Needs Help

Wondering if your home has a flashing problem? Look for these signs in your Ennis home:

  • Water stains on ceilings or near your fireplace
  • Rust streaks on the chimney exterior
  • Shingles or roof edges curling near the chimney
  • Musty odors in the attic or living room
  • Visible gaps between chimney and roof materials
  • Drips or trickles during or after heavy rain

Not sure? Grab a flashlight and check your attic after a rainstorm. Even if there are no puddles yet, look for damp wood, stains, or that telltale musty smell.
